Warrenville's Nursing Job Market: A Growing Hub for Healthcare Professionals with Competitive Salaries and Expanding Opportunities

Warrenville cityscape

Here in Warrenville, Illinois, the nursing job market is both dynamic and evolving, characterized by a blend of suburban tranquility and proximity to the bustling healthcare landscape of the Chicago metropolitan area. Nestled amidst the natural beauty of the DuPage County Forest Preserve and just a short drive from larger cities, Warrenville offers a commendable quality of life. As registered nurses and nursing professionals, we can find opportunities that align with a supportive community while being near major healthcare infrastructures. Based on recent data from the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, the average salary for nurses in Illinois stands at approximately $36.76 per hour, with an annual salary clocking in around $76,450. For Warrenville specifically, we could estimate the average nursing salaries to range between $34.00 to $38.50 per hour, depending on experience and specialty. This range is slightly lower than the state's average, but it remains competitive given the city’s cost of living and connections to the larger metropolitan healthcare sector.

The nursing job market in Warrenville shows promising growth, with an estimated 5-7% increase in demand for nursing professionals projected over the next five years. Currently, there are roughly 1,200 registered nurses employed in our city, correlating approximately to the population share of DuPage County, which has a significant concentration of healthcare facilities. With the ever-increasing demand for quality healthcare services, it's expected that Warrenville, along with nearby cities like Naperville and Aurora, will experience a rise in job openings, especially for travel and per diem nursing roles. Warrenville may not be recognized as a central hub for travel nursing, but the seasonal fluctuation does bring a noticeable uptick in travel nurse positions during peak summer months, often catering to community health events and increased patient volumes in hospitals. Per diem roles are also robust here, providing essential flexibility that many nurses seek today. Meanwhile, neighboring cities offer varied salary ranges — Naperville, known for its higher cost of living, can provide upwards of $40.00 per hour. In contrast, Aurora, with a more extensive healthcare network, supplies competitive wages but often demands specialized skills.

As we consider our healthcare infrastructure, Warrenville boasts several notable establishments, including the DuPage Medical Group and the nearby Edward Hospital, which play a crucial role in our community’s health. These facilities continually seek nurses, particularly in specialized areas such as emergency care, pediatrics, and geriatrics. With recent investments in healthcare technology and increased funding for public health initiatives, our local nursing professionals are essential in adapting to evolving healthcare needs. The population of Warrenville stands at around 13,000, with ongoing growth projections that signal an increasing need for healthcare services. Frequently Asked Questions About Nursing in Warrenville

Do I need to be licensed in Illinois to work in Warrenville?
Yes, Illinois has not adopted the eNLC compact agreement, so you will need to hold a Illinois nursing license.
